Enhanced broadband NIR emission in glass-ceramic fibers containing Nd3+/Yb3+ co-doped YCa4O(BO3)(3) disordered nanocrystal

Demands are increasing for ultrashort pulse laser in industrial applications, where the gain bandwidth of most optical fiber material is not wide enough, and developing a wide bandwidth gain medium is challenging. Glass-ceramic fibers containing Nd3+/Yb3+ co-doped YCa4O(BO3)(3) nanocrystals were fabricated by the molten core method and successive heat treatment. After a careful heat treatment, Nd3+/Yb3+ co-doped YCa4O(BO3)(3) nanocrystals were precipitated in the fiber core. Enhanced broadband near-infrared (NIR) emission from 850 to 1150 nm (bandwidth: similar to 252 nm) was obtained in the glass-ceramic fiber compared to that of precursor fiber. These results suggest that the Nd3+/Yb3+ glass-ceramic fibers are promising for broadband NIR optical amplifications and lasers.
